If you love to entertain, your outdoor space—no matter how compact—can become a vibrant social hub. The key is choosing urban outdoor furniture that balances style, comfort, and functionality for small groups. Here’s what works best.
First, consider a bistro set. A round or square table with two to four chairs is ideal for intimate dinners or coffee chats. Look for foldable or stackable models if space is tight, and opt for weather-resistant materials like powder-coated aluminum or synthetic wicker.
For lounging, a modular sofa set or a sectional with a low coffee table invites relaxed conversation. Choose pieces with removable, quick-dry cushions in fade-resistant fabrics. A compact L-shape or two-seater with an ottoman can accommodate three to five guests without overwhelming a balcony or small patio.
Bar-height tables with stools are another excellent choice. They create a casual, standing-party vibe and save floor space. Pair them with a small side table for drinks or snacks.
Don’t forget multifunctional pieces like storage benches that double as seating, or nesting tables that can be separated for extra surface area. To define the area, add an outdoor rug and soft lighting—string lights or lanterns create warmth.
Finally, prioritize furniture that is lightweight and easy to rearrange. Urban entertaining often means adapting to different guest counts and moods. With the right setup, your outdoor space will become the go-to spot for memorable small gatherings.
